The Salzlandsparkasse is a public-law savings bank based in Staßfurt . It is one of the municipal savings banks in Germany . Its business area includes the Salzlandkreis , which is also the owner of the Sparkasse.

organization structure

The Salzlandsparkasse is an institution under public law . The legal basis is the Savings Bank Act for Saxony-Anhalt. The organs of the Sparkasse are the board of directors , the credit committee and the administrative board .

The Salzlandsparkasse has 46 branches and 11 self-service locations with a total of 68 ATMs and 54 account statement printers. The Salzlandsparkasse also has a 100% subsidiary:

  • Sparkassen Verwaltungsgesellschaft mbH (SVG)

history

Today's Salzlandsparkasse is essentially the result of the merger of two savings banks:

  • Kreissparkasse Aschersleben-Staßfurt (formerly Kreissparkasse Aschersleben and Kreissparkasse Staßfurt)
  • Sparkasse Elbe-Saale (formerly Kreissparkasse Bernburg and Kreissparkasse Schönebeck)

In 1935 the Schönebecker Sparkasse took its seat in the Villa Siegel in Schönebeck. Since January 1st, 2009 the institute has been called "Salzlandsparkasse".
